Rays win Radnor Wayne Little League Minors Championship

They beat the Orioles 7-4.

On Saturday June 11 Radnor-Wayne Little League baseball had their championship game for the minors division between the Orioles and the Rays.  The Orioles finished the regular season in first place with a 12-1 record, followed in second place by the Rays with a 9-3 record.

The game was low scoring and close, with the Rays holding a 2 to 0 lead into the fourth inning. The Rays scored their first run on an inside the park home run by Will Foxman.

Ray’s pitcher Grady Nance pitched a fantastic four-and-two-thirds innings. The Rays exploded with a five-run fifth inning with Chris Massaro and Gabe Furey with two out hits, each driving in two runs.

Massaro closed out the game on the mound, and Nance and Massaro combined for the 7-4 victory.  The game ended on a diving catch of a foul ball by Will Foxman. The Rays were coached by Chris Massaro and Dewey McKay, and assisted by Damien Morabito and Mike Nance.
